Floods Leave a Trail of Destruction in Homabay

An estimated 1,500 people and 2,000 students are in need of emergency support after raging floods hit south west Kenya.

Two months ago, residents of Homabay County could never have predicted that the rainy season, which allows them to plant crops and feed their animals, would cause so much destruction.

However, as the rains intensified, they swelled streams and rivers, creating pounding flood waters that swept away people, animals, crops, and buildings.
